"Bar beneath the Mercure hotel, opened December 2016. Décor is dark wood, giving this more of a pub feeling than a hotel bar.
Historic Interest
An impressive recently fitted-out hotel bar in the Nottingham's oldest surviving historic hotel, the George Hotel. Once one of Nottingham's premiere hotels, apparently, the likes of Charles Dickens, Henry Irving, Elizabeth Taylor and Richard Burton have stayed there. Originally a Coaching Inn dating from 1822 and then known as the George the Fourth (Whitworth 2010). Note the viewing panel near the door which shows the first of several layers of cave cellars. The Curious Tavern is located in Nottingham City Council's Lace Market Conservation Area."
